UF’s journalism school unveils Authentically, a new AI-powered program that reduces bias in writing Brian Smith February 26, 2026 Share Researchers at the College of Journalism and Communications are preparing to launch Authentically, an AI-powered editing tool designed to eliminate bias in the news The program was built by an interdisciplinary group of students from across campus, including the College of Engineering and the College of the Arts Authentically is simple to use, customizable and flexible, which could give it
